What is Micetro?

Micetro is a software that provides centralized management for DNS, DHCP, and IP address management, collectively known as DDI. The software enables organizations to automate network configurations, streamline administrative tasks, and enforce policies across complex network environments. Micetro supports integration with cloud and on-premises network infrastructure, offering visibility into IP address usage and facilitating compliance with network governance standards. The software addresses business needs related to reducing manual errors, improving network availability, and enhancing operational efficiency in managing core network services.

    Robust Multi-Vendor DDI Overlay with Scalability and Automation Benefits Tempered by some UI and API Endpoint Limitations

    4.0
    May 11, 2026
    As the implementation lead, my experience was for the most part positive due to the product's non-intrusive overlay architecture. Unlike traditional DDI migrations that require hardware upgrades of some sort, Micetro allowed us to bring our existing Microsoft and Bind Servers under a unified management pane in a matter of days rather than months. The experience, though, had its own challenges. Micetro is an excellent mirror, it showed us in rather explicit ways how messy the data we had was and that made the first 30 days of implementation a heavy lift for the team in terms of data cleansing.

    Orchestrate your DNS/DHCP services automatically to boost your IPAM

    5.0
    Nov 15, 2024
    Orchestrates our DHCP/DNS services without replacing them, with simplicity, efficiency and easy of installation. Works fine with Microsoft services. IPAM is able to collect via SNMP the different IP ranges from our Cisco Catalyst/Nexus switches.

Like

The most standout feature for me about Micetro is the REST Api and the Terraform Provider. They allow for fast and efficient deployment. We were able to automate IPAM assignments within our CI/CD Pipeline in about 12 working days. The second thing I liked about Micetro is not specifically about the product itself but their support. It's a rare experience when you get technically proficient support from Enterprise solution providers. Bluecat's support team is just that. If you open a ticket, you are assured of getting a tier 2 resource within less than 24 hours, and most of them understand BIND and Windows DNS internals. The third thing that Micetro has going for it in my opinion is its scalability. The organization for which we deployed the solution for has a presence in three countries and we were able to scale across those countries. We can manage local DNS nodes via thin agents which is a highly efficient utilization of both bandwidth and latency management.

Dislike

One of the most noticeable weaknesses I noticed occurred when syncing complex Microsoft DHCP failover relationships. You had times when these produced ghost leases in the UI and you had to manually refresh the agent services to get them cleared out. The second issue I had with Micetro was that even though the documentation was great, when we stumbled across some obscure API endpoints then you ran into the lack of robustness. The third, and perhaps the most glaring, is noticeable when transitioning between the legacy management console and the newer Web UI. The experience is jarring, especially given that some advanced features have not yet been fully migrated to the web-based interface.

Dislike

Doesn't support Palo Alto SNMP pooling. Embeeded reporting doesn't mix datasource (DNS and IPAM) - you have to combine the results yourself if you have a specific need.
